BIMStorm™ Awards
Awards will be decided for:
- Best Demonstration of Interoperability - Focusing on data
and
information flowing between different tools. The currency of the
information age is information, show us how you share it.
- Best Urban Planning - Alexandria and Tshwane will both
have an urban planning aspect to them. Show us how urban planning
solutions can have a positive impact on our cities and world.
- Best Design - Overall design that integrates the
challenges defined in each BIMStorm.
- Best Collaboration - Virtual and face to face
collaboration,
show us what is possible with collaboration using the tools of today.
- Multi Discipline Design - Integrated multi disciplined
teams sharing knowledge.
- Continuous Publication - We want to see it live. Show us
how
you can share your good and bad decisions continuously and use these
scenarios to make better decisions.
- Best Security Plan - Our environment shapes us. Show how
security planning using CPTED, Crime Prevention Through Environmental
Design can create safer communities.
- Green Award - Enough said.
- Most in Depth Study - How far can the teams go in breadth
and depth of the designs. We want to see examples of both.
- BIMStorm Award - Jury’s Choice

BIMStorm™ Alexandria, Virginia - Federal Friendly
Zones™ - September 9-11, 2008
From
September 9-11, 2008, federal and city agencies, owners, developers,
planners, architects, builders and the public will gather for a live
BIMStorm™ for the Alexandria, VA area. Due to Base
Realignment and
Closing (BRAC) in the area, the demographics of Alexandria will be
changing. The Alexandria BIMStorm™ will be an exercise to
plan for this
change and run scenarios.

BIMStorm™ Capitals Alliance: South Africa - September 2008
The
National Capital Planning Commission (NCPC), the central planning
agency for America’s capital, will host Capitals Alliance
2008:
Greening the World’s Capital Cities, in Washington, DC
September 15-18,
2008. The conference will assemble planners, designers, architects, and
policy-makers from national capitals around the world to explore the
role of capital cities in creating a greener planet. This year,
Capitals Alliance will focus on a master planning charrette of Tshwane,
the capital of South Africa. BIMStorm™ Capitals Alliance will
allow
participants from around the world to observe and design.
